我正在用Java做一个个人项目,我正试图快速地构建一个没有重复的字符串。让我给你举一个具体的例子:
String s = null;
for (char c : tableChars) {
s += c;
}
好的,我知道我可以检查这个字符是否已经在字符串中,但我必须在每次插入时查找它。还有别的办法吗?
我正在寻找一种通用的机器控制文件格式与设备接口。该设备由各种阀门、泵和加热器组成,并运行嵌入式C。我希望能够控制这些设备在由文件定义的‘脚本’中激活的顺序。如果该格式还支持循环或条件语句,那就更好了,如果非技术用户能够理解和编写脚本文件,那就更好了。该文件将由机器的固件解析。 如下所示,将指令重复5次: LOOP, 5
VALVE, ON, 100ms
HEATER, ON, 200degrees
PAUSE, 60s
VALVE, OFF
END 有这样的格式吗?或者我实现我自己的会更好?快速浏览一下就会发现,在最近的版本中,GCode可以支持循环,但它的可
我有一个数据帧,每个人都被分配了一个文本id,它连接了一个地名和一个个人id (参见下面的数据)。最终,我需要将数据集从“长”转换为“宽”(例如,使用“重塑”),以便每个个体只包含一行。为了做到这一点,我需要分配一个“时间”变量,reshape可以使用它来识别时变的协变量等。我有(可能不好的)代码来为重复两次以上的人做这件事,但需要能够识别多达18次重复出现的情况。如果我删除散列前面的行,下面的代码可以很好地工作,但只能标识最多两个重复。如果我把这一行留在中(对于重复两次以上的个体,这似乎是必要的),R就会卡住,给出以下错误(可能是因为第一个个体只重复两次):
Error in if (dat
我的情况是,我试图实现一些我不确定C++是否支持的东西。
举个例子:
class foo
{
public:
type item1;
type item2;
}
class fooList
{
public:
foo list;
type getFooMember(member)
{
return list.member
}
}
有没有办法写一个函数"getFooMember"?从本质上讲,我正在编写一个模板化的二进制搜索树。我希望存储相同类型的项目,然而,类的一个对象将按名称存储,另一个对象将按月
解决99 lisp问题的解决方案: P08,带有函数javascript
如果列表包含重复的元素,则应将其替换为元素的单个副本。不应改变元素的顺序。
* (compress '(a a a a b c c a a d e e e e))
(A B C A D E)
有人想复习一下吗?
function cond( check, _then, _continuation ) {
if(check) return _then( _continuation )
else return _continuation()
}
function compress( list )